Sony Ericsson Xperia Ray Price & Specs

Specifications
General
Status | Discontinued |
Released | Mon Aug 01 2011 12:00:00 GMT+0500 (Pakistan Standard Time) |
Build
OS | Android OS v2.3 (Gingerbread) |
Dimensions | 111 x 53 x 9.4 mm |
Weight | 100 g |
SIM | SIM data not available |
Colors | Black, Gold, White, Pink |
Frequency
2G Network | G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900 |
3G Network | HSDPA 900 / 2100 (ST18i), HSDPA 850 / 1900 / 2100 (ST18a) |
4G Network | Not Available |
5G Band | Not Available |
Processor
CPU | 1 GHz |
Chipset | Qualcomm MSM8255 Snapdragon |
GPU | Adreno 205 |
Display
Technology | LED-backlit LCD, capacitive touchscreen, 16M colors |
Size | 3.3 inches |
Resolution | 480 x 854 pixels |
Protection | Scratch Resistant Glass |
Extra Features | Bravia Mobile engine, Touch sensitive controls |
Memory
Built-in | 1GB built-in (300 MB user available), 512 MB RAM |
Card | microSD card included (supports up to 32GB) |
Camera
Main | 8MP, 3264x2448 pixels, autofocus, LED flash |
Features | 7 |
Front | No |
Connectivity
WLAN |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n, DLNA, Wi-Fi hotspot |
Bluetooth | v2.1 with A2DP, EDR |
GPS | Yes + A-GPS support |
USB | Yes |
NFC | No |
Data | GPRS (86 kbps), EDGE (237 kbps), 3G (HSDPA 7.2 Mbps, HSUPA 5.8 Mbps) |
Infrared | N/A |
FM Radio | Stereo FM radio with RDS |
Features
Sensors | Accelerometer, proximity, compass |
Audio | 3.5mm audio jack |
Browser | HTML, Adobe Flash |
Games | built-in |
Torch | Yes |
Extra | SensMe, Google Search, Maps, Gmail, Document viewer, Predictive text input, Speakerphone |

The Sony Ericsson Xperia Ray, despite its age, boasted several impressive features. Its sleek design, a hallmark of Sony Ericsson’s branding, immediately set it apart. The compact size (111 x 53 x 9.4 mm) and lightweight build (100g) made it incredibly comfortable to hold and use. The Sony Ericsson Xperia Ray Price & Specs were attractive, especially considering the quality of the device.
At the heart of the Xperia Ray was its vibrant 3.3-inch display with a resolution of 480 x 854 pixels. While this might seem low by today’s standards, it offered sharp, clear visuals for its time. The inclusion of Bravia Mobile Engine further enhanced the viewing experience, optimizing image and video quality for a richer visual experience. The Sony Ericsson Xperia Ray Price & Specs made it a strong contender in its era.
Photography enthusiasts appreciated the 8.1-megapixel camera, equipped with the Exmor R for mobile image sensor. This technology ensured decent image quality even in low-light conditions. While lacking a front-facing camera, a common feature today, the rear camera compensated for its absence in many ways, showcasing the thoughtful design of Sony Ericsson Xperia Ray Price & Specs. The camera’s capabilities contributed significantly to the overall value proposition of the Sony Ericsson Xperia Ray Price & Specs.
Furthermore, the Xperia Ray ran on Android OS v2.3 (Gingerbread), offering a relatively smooth user experience for its time. Its 1 GHz Qualcomm MSM8255 Snapdragon processor, coupled with 512 MB of RAM, ensured decent performance for everyday tasks. The inclusion of microSD card support allowed for expandable storage, addressing the limited 1GB built-in storage (300MB user-available).
